3. Granite Price Variations
Granite prices can vary widely, depending on the type, color, and pattern.
High-End Granite: Some unique granites, such as blue granite or those with rare patterns, tend to be more expensive. Their exclusivity and beauty make them perfect for high-end kitchens.
Mid-Range Granite: Common colors like white and gray granite are priced in the mid-range. These offer both durability and aesthetic appeal, making them a popular choice for modern kitchens.
Budget Granite: For those with a tighter budget, basic granite colors like black or dark gray are affordable options. These provide good looks and durability at a lower cost.
